In this tutorial, we will try to recreate the realistic Cracked Skin Effect in Photoshop. Let the fun begins.
Strep 1
Open in Photoshop the image you want to use for this tutorial, click on file - place embedded to upload the crack image that you can download for free on the source file. Resize and rotate the image so that fits nicely on a face, change the blending mode to multiply. In my case, I want to add some effect on a neck as well so I duplicate the image.
Step 2
Add a layer mask to the crack layer and with a soft brush, set on black color, paint over the places that you don't wont to have the crack effect.
Step 3
Add the levels adjustment layer, click on a clipping mask so that levels apply only on the crack layer. Move the white point slider to about 153. Go back to the crack layer mask and with brush erase small bits from the face especially the mouth and eyes area.
Step 4
Add the hue/saturation adjustment layer, move the saturation slider to -20. Add a new layer, merge all layers using shortcuts, press and hold the SHIFT key + CTRL + ALT + E. This will make a stamp of all layers this is a non-destructive way to merge layers. With a Quick Selection Tool select IRIS of both eyes so that we can change the color of the eyes. Hold Ctrl + J to make a copy of the eyes in a new layer.
Step 5
Add the hue/saturation adjustment layer, move the saturation slider to + 83, and the hue slider to + 12 or you can play with colors and choose a different color. Add clipping mask so that we apple color only on the eye layer.
Step 6
Add the color lookup adjustment layer - 3DLUT file - Foggy Night 3DL, blend mode - Hue and reduce the opacity to around 50%.
Step 7
Add the curves adjustment layer to brighten the image.
Step 8
Add another curves adjustment layer this time in 'S' shape to add some dramatic look and some contrast.
